Translating Academic Excellence into Industry Appeal

\n

Graduate studies equip you with specialized knowledge and advanced research skills, but effectively communicating these to a non-academic audience can be a challenge. Professional resume writers specializing in graduate-level careers understand how to bridge this gap. They can help you reframe your thesis, dissertation, or research projects into quantifiable achievements and demonstrate the transferable skills you’ve acquired – critical thinking, problem-solving, data analysis, project management, and leadership. For instance, a Ph.D. candidate in biology might have extensive experience in genetic sequencing. A resume writer can translate this into \»Managed and executed complex DNA sequencing protocols, leading to a 15% increase in data accuracy for a multi-year research grant.\» This kind of translation is vital for roles in biotechnology firms or pharmaceutical companies.

\n

Consider the current economic climate in the US. Companies are increasingly looking for candidates who can hit the ground running and demonstrate immediate value. A well-crafted resume, often developed with the help of a professional service, can highlight your ability to contribute from day one. For example, a recent MBA graduate might have completed a capstone project that identified cost-saving measures for a local business, resulting in a projected annual saving of $50,000. This specific, quantifiable outcome is far more impactful than simply stating \»Completed a capstone project.\» The practical tip here is to always think in terms of results and impact when describing your experiences, and a professional writer can help you identify and articulate these effectively.

Tailoring Your Narrative for the US Job Market

\n

The US job market is diverse, with specific industries and regions having unique hiring preferences. A generic resume simply won’t cut it. Professional resume services excel at tailoring your application materials to specific job descriptions and industries. They understand the nuances of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) that many US companies use to screen resumes, ensuring your document is optimized for keywords and formatting. For example, if you’re applying for a data science role in Silicon Valley, your resume needs to prominently feature skills like Python, R, machine learning, and big data technologies, alongside specific project examples. If you’re targeting a position in Washington D.C.’s policy sector, emphasis might shift to research methodologies, legislative analysis, and public speaking experience.

\n

Furthermore, understanding US workplace culture and expectations is crucial. This includes how to present your work experience, academic achievements, and extracurricular activities in a way that aligns with American professional norms. For instance, while some cultures might emphasize modesty, US employers often value confidence and a clear articulation of one’s contributions. A statistic to consider: studies have shown that resumes tailored to specific job descriptions can receive up to 4 times more responses than generic ones. A practical tip is to identify 2-3 key skills or experiences that are most relevant to the jobs you’re applying for and ensure they are highlighted prominently on your resume, ideally within the first third of the document.
